Metal glove molds, particularly those made from stainless steel, offer several advantages over ceramic glove molds. For one, metal glove molds have excellent thermal conductivity, meaning that they can be used to speed up the baking and curing process. With a metal mold, the baking and curing process can be completed in just two minutes, compared to six minutes with a ceramic mold. This increased efficiency means that metal glove molds can increase production capacity by up to three times that of ceramic molds. Additionally, the use of metal molds can result in energy savings, making them a more environmentally friendly option.

In addition to their superior thermal conductivity and energy efficiency, stainless steel glove molds also offer several other advantages over their ceramic counterparts. For example, metal molds are more durable and long-lasting, with a lifespan of up to 10 years or more, compared to just 2-3 years for ceramic molds. Metal molds are also more resistant to wear and tear, and are less likely to crack or break. Additionally, stainless steel glove molds are easier to clean and maintain than ceramic molds, and are more hygienic, as they do not absorb bacteria or odors.

Overall, the many advantages of stainless steel glove molds have made them the preferred choice for glove factories around the world. By switching to metal molds, factories can increase production efficiency, reduce energy consumption, and improve the quality and lifespan of their gloves.

Nowadays, most glove manufacturers have shifted towards using stainless steel glove molds instead of ceramic ones. This is due to several factors, including the shorter curing time, better surface finish, and easier maintenance and cleaning of metal molds. Moreover, stainless steel molds offer a longer lifespan and are less prone to breakage or chipping, reducing the need for frequent replacements and downtime.

On the other hand, ceramic molds have several disadvantages, such as their longer curing time, which results in a lower production capacity and higher energy consumption. Ceramic molds are also more fragile and susceptible to breakage, which can cause defects in the gloves and result in production delays.
